About the role:

As our Merchandise Commercial Manager, you'll lead a team of Commercial Analysts who provide the financial insight, modelling and commercial recommendations that help shape key decisions across the Merchandise function. Reporting to the Head of Merchandise – Commercial, you'll help shape commercial decisions are informed by robust analysis, clear narratives, and a strong understanding of performance drivers.

 

More than reporting on results, you'll lead work that helps shape category strategy and commercial decision-making. Through strategic category reviews, commercial performance reviews, and cost-to-serve analysis, you'll identify opportunities to influence the direction and commercial outcomes of the business.

 

Just as importantly, you'll lead and develop a high-performing team, creating an environment where people are supported, challenged, and equipped to grow their capability. You'll provide coaching on complex commercial reviews, drive continuous improvement, and foster a collaborative and learning-focused culture.

 

Key responsibilities:

  • Lead the commercial side of our category review process, ensuring opportunities are identified and targeted financial outcomes are achieved.
  • Influence commercial decision-making through robust analysis, insights, and recommendations to senior stakeholders.
  • Lead the development and ongoing improvement of reporting, tools, and frameworks that support commercial performance and decision-making, including helping shape our approach to AI-enabled insights and analysis.
  • Build trusted relationships across Merchandise, Finance, and the wider business to drive alignment and achieve commercial objectives.

About us:

We’re a team of 14,000 who make sure South Islanders have access to the groceries and essentials they need. Proudly 100% Kiwi-owned and operated, our co-operative has more than 180 PAK’nSAVE, New World, Four Square and On the Spot stores feeding the South Island.
